Output 63df47196c176106c891f714b1b52f446f61aa8fa39e706c936868056fc0c47d:0

value
35581270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b605667c50206cee7fccb1c240ca1ae17a6f83c OP_EQUAL
address
3EPyFrdTWNFrR5qiW5Hb3fntJKi6Jho6KF
transaction
63df47196c176106c891f714b1b52f446f61aa8fa39e706c936868056fc0c47d
spent
true